Synopsis

Explore the rich tapestry of "Portuguese Architecture" in this meticulously prepared edition by Walter Crum Watson. A comprehensive journey through the architectural history of Portugal, this book examines the diverse styles, influential designs, and significant buildings that define the nation's unique aesthetic. From grand cathedrals to humble dwellings, discover the evolution of architectural expression across the Portuguese landscape.

An invaluable resource for students, enthusiasts, and anyone captivated by European architectural history, this volume provides a detailed overview of Portugal's contributions to the world of building design. Delve into the specifics of architectural movements and gain insight into the cultural forces that shaped Portugal's iconic structures. "Portuguese Architecture" offers a timeless perspective on a captivating subject.
